Road Trip Across America 1973 (Segment 3)

Segment 3 (Columbus → Indianapolis via US‑40) will be a hybrid of Midwest garage/power‑pop regional singles, MOR/soft‑rock AM obscurities, and country‑rock that actually charted on Ohio/Indiana surveys but never broke nationally. This is the most regionally accurate sound of the entire trip so far — the Midwest in ’73 had a very specific AM flavor: bright, melodic, slightly sentimental, and full of local bands who were huge at home and invisible everywhere else.
